Transaction dd7075cf7519f94ea2f8678426a9c53aafacfcce0d38387c8776ff5418eb7aa8

33 Input
2 Outputs
  • dd7075cf7519f94ea2f8678426a9c53aafacfcce0d38387c8776ff5418eb7aa8:0
  • value  44541282
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• dd7075cf7519f94ea2f8678426a9c53aafacfcce0d38387c8776ff5418eb7aa8:1
  • value  2186110997
    address  1PANDAcsGhEgC6epjA9NwdUwfN6sjWLmuQ